Wye Valley NHS Trust was caring for 33 coronavirus patients in hospital as of Tuesday, figures show.

NHS England data shows the number of people being treated in hospital for Covid-19 by 8am on January 4 was up from 15 on the same day the previous week.

The number of beds at Wye Valley NHS Trust occupied by people who tested positive for Covid-19 increased by 83% in the last four weeks – 28 days ago, there were 18.

Across England there were 9,332 people in hospital with Covid as of January 4, with 212 of them in mechanical ventilation beds.

The number of Covid-19 patients hospitalised nationally has increased by 70% in the last four weeks, while the number on mechanical ventilators has increased by 78%.

The figures also show that 35 new Covid patients were admitted to hospital in Wye Valley NHS Trust in the week to January 2. This was up from 15 in the previous seven days.
